This video explains why "boring" videos can be more effective for business growth on YouTube than flashy, viral content. The speaker, Ed Lawrence, outlines four foundational elements that make these simple videos successful: managing viewer expectations, making content listenable like a podcast, reducing cognitive load for viewers, and projecting certainty in your delivery. He argues that this approach is more sustainable and profitable for businesses in the long run, especially as AI-generated content becomes more prevalent.
